Youth rodeo finals to take place this weekend
Published 2:09 pm Thursday, May 12, 2016
QUITMAN – The Georgia Florida Youth Rodeo will host its first finals Saturday and Sunday.
Participants range in age from 3 up to 19 with approximately 50 participants competing for $12,000 in awards.
Typical rodeo events will be held, including roping and riding.
The rodeo will begin each day at 10 a.m. and is expected to last anywhere from 2 to 4 hours, according to Serena Johnson of Georgia Florida Youth Rodeo.
A rodeo queen and princess contest will be held at 4 p.m. Saturday. Contestants will have a one-on-one interview, give speeches, answer a rodeo related question followed by a reining pattern.
All awards, including the crowning of the queen and princess, will take place Sunday.
A special cowboy church service will be held Sunday as well for those who wish to attend.
The rodeo will be held at J2 Arena, located at 125 Roberts Road in Quitman.
